Schools cancel in-person classes for Friday in advance of winter storm

Homewood and Flossmoor schools have canceled in-person classes for Friday, Jan. 12, after the National Weather Service issued a winter storm warning for the area. Six or more inches of wet snow and high winds are expected through Saturday morning.

Flossmoor District 161 officials said buildings will be closed and students will participate in e-learning classes from home. 

The school day will begin at 8 a.m. and end at 1:30 p.m. 

The district announcement on Facebook also noted that temperatures are expected to be dangerously low on Tuesday, Jan. 16. The district will communicate with families if classes are affected next week.

Homewood District 153 schools will also hold e-learning classes Friday so students and staff do not have to travel to school during the storm.

Marian Catholic High School in Chicago Heights announced on Facebook that classes will be canceled Friday.

As of Thursday evening, no announcements were made regarding after-school sports-related activities.

At 8:45 p.m. there had been no public announcement regarding Homewood-Flossmoor High School classes.

Area schools will also be closed Monday, Jan. 15, for the Martin Luther King Jr. holiday.
